'Smallville' Producers Jump Ship To 'Melrose Place'
By BRYANT GRIFFIN
Feb-11-2009



The CW is placing "Smallville" executive producers Todd Slavkin and Darren Swimmer at the helm of the "Melrose Place" reboot.

With a ninth season of "Smallville" likely, Slavkin and Swimmer's departure leaves Brian Peterson and Kelly Souders to assume the reins. This marks another shift in "Smallville's" management following the exit of Alfred Gough and Miles Millar at the conclusion of Season 7.

Recent "Melrose Place" casting breakdowns offer a peek into the producer's new neighborhood. Entertainment Weekly reports the show includes the characters of David Patterson (the son of Jake), Ella Flynn (a public relations whiz with a sharp tongue), Auggie Kirkpatrick (a recovering alcoholic), Jonah Miller (who strives to be the next Kevin Smith), and Violet Foster (a small-town girl).

Mark Schwahn, creator of "One Tree Hill," was anticipated to pilot the "Melrose Place" rebirth, but a deal never materialized.
